INTERPOL-led operation has resulted in 5,811 arrests, blocked more than 31,000 bank accounts, and intercepted $293 million in illicit assets across 97 countries and territories during a global crackdown on fraud and crypto-linked money laundering. According to an INTERPOL statement…
